The most important part of your renovation is the part you'll never see.

Once the drywall goes up, your Mechanical, Electrical, and Plumbing (MEP) systems are hidden behind the walls for decades. If they're outdated, undersized, or poorly planned, you'll feel the consequences every day—tripped breakers, weak water pressure, uneven temperatures, and expensive future repairs.

Many century homes were built long before today's electrical loads, HVAC expectations, and plumbing demands existed. What worked 100 years ago wasn't designed for EV chargers, smart home technology, multi-zone comfort, or multiple bathrooms running simultaneously.

That's why opening the walls during a renovation is a critical opportunity.

A properly planned MEP upgrade can include:
✔️ Electrical systems designed for modern power demands
✔️ Multi-zone heating and cooling for consistent comfort
✔️ Upgraded plumbing for reliable pressure and hot water delivery
✔️ Infrastructure that supports future technology and lifestyle changes

The best renovations don't just improve what you see—they improve how your home performs every single day.

The biggest mistake in a century home renovation isn't what you change.

It's what you remove without understanding why it was there in the first place.

Great interior planning starts with a room-by-room assessment. Original trim, historic layouts, structural quirks, moisture patterns, and decades of repairs all tell a story. The goal isn't to erase that history—it's to make the home work better while protecting what makes it special.

Many older homes already have a logical flow. The challenge is improving circulation, comfort, and functionality without unnecessary demolition that strips away character.

The same applies to materials and systems. Modern upgrades should complement the way an older home was built. From moisture-aware insulation to carefully planned HVAC, electrical, and lighting upgrades, the best renovations respect the original structure while delivering modern performance.

A successful century home renovation isn't about making an old house look new.

It's about making it perform better while keeping the character that made you fall in love with it in the first place.
